Update For Kent County Community Action's Food Assistance Program

We would like to share a few programmatic changes with you.

The Emergency Food Assistance Program (TEFAP) Income Guidelines have increased to match the 2024 Federal Poverty Guidelines for income eligibility. Clients can still be eligible for TEFAP by needing food and/or if they participated in any of the following programs:

  • Special Supplemental Nutrition Program for Women, Infants, and Children (WIC);
  • Commodity Supplemental Food Program (CSFP);
  • Supplemental Food Assistance Program (SNAP);
  • Supplemental Security Income (SSI); or
  • Food Distribution Program on Indian Reservations (FDPIR).

In addition, we are bringing additional TEFAP distributions back to our office located at 121 Martin Luther King Jr. Street SE.

Last, due to funding changes, our Commodity Supplemental Food Program (CSFP) is currently on a wait list. We are continuing to accept applications through our several distribution sites; however, new applicants are not able to receive a food box at the time of distribution until further notice.
